This hiking route takes you through a beautiful area, with a total distance of 7.212 kilometers and an elevation gain of 217 meters. The duration of the hike is approximately 2 hours and 12 minutes, making it a difficult but rewarding trek.
As you start your journey, you will come across Hourquette d'Ancizan, a natural saddle offering stunning views of the surrounding landscape. Although it is not directly on the trail, it is a worthwhile pit stop at the beginning of your hike.
Continuing on, you will pass by Clot de Portillou, a peak that may require a slight detour from the main trail but provides a picturesque vantage point.
Along the way, you will encounter two springs, providing a refreshing opportunity to fill up your water bottle and take a break. The first spring, located just 0.03 kilometers from the start, is easily accessible, while the second one is 3.22 kilometers into the hike.
As you approach the midpoint of the trail, you will reach Lac d'Arou, a serene lake surrounded by natural beauty. This is a perfect spot to rest and enjoy a peaceful moment before heading back on the same route.
